We are seeking a highly organized and proactive Payroll, AP & Compliance Manager to support critical business operations at our Bridgeport WV office.. This role is ideal for someone who enjoys balancing financial processes with compliance and safety responsibilities, takes ownership of their work, and wants to make a meaningful impact across multiple areas of the organization.

Key Responsibilities:&
&
Payroll & Accounts Payable
- Process bi-weekly and semi-monthly payroll cycles in Paycor, including maintaining employee pay records and ensuring accurate, timely disbursement
- Reconcile payroll registers prior to processing and resolve discrepancies before reimbursement
- Administer payroll tax filings and ensure compliance with federal, state, and local payroll tax requirements
- Coordinate year-end payroll activities including W-2 preparation and distribution through Paycor
- Respond to employee inquires related to pay, deductions, and Paycor self-service functionality
- Review, code, and route vendor invoices to the appropriate project or cost center in accordance with the company chart of accounts
- Own the accounts payable process end-to-end, including invoice intake, coding/approval workflow, weekly check runs and ACH/EFT disbursements, and document retention
- Maintain vendor master records and W-9 documentation; manage annual 1099-NEC and 1099-MISC analysis and reporting
- Reconcile the accounts payable subledger to the general ledger at month-end and assist with AP aging analysis and reporting&
- Support month-end and year-end close activities related to accounts payable, including accruals and cutoff procedures&
- Communicate with vendors and subcontractors to resolve invoice disputes, payment discrepancies, and statement reconciliation
Compliance and Safety
- Prepare monthly and annual safety reporting (e.g., incident metrics, OSHA logs, and internal compliance tracking)
- Ensure safety compliance with all applicable regulations and company policies
- Order and maintain safety supplies and inventory
- Perform 401(k) auditing and compliance activities&
HR & Administrative Support
- Administer workers' compensation claims, including incident/accident reporting, documentation, and coordination with carriers and internal stakeholders
- Manage and process unemployment claims&
- Conduct safety orientation for new hires
- Administer the drug testing program
- Assist with various HR projects as needed
